Artists For A Better World held a Meeting and Salon at the home of founding member Lynda Hubbard in Sylmar, CA. The meeting was put on by AFABW Founder Barbara Cordova Oliver, with the help of Lauren Perreau. Artists came together who share the purpose of creating a better world through aesthetics and support of top social betterment programs.

The attendees all introduced themselves and some also shared their art and music. Some have been part of AFABW over the years and others were new.

Barbara covered some of the history of AFABW and talked about events done last year. She then read some updated goals and purposes – and went over the organizing board and what hats are currently needed.

There were announcements of upcoming events and projects. Becky Mate spoke about World Art Day – an annual event she will host at her home on April 15th which is DaVinci’s Birthday. This day is a validation of the importance of the arts. Becky likens it to any other International holiday, but this one is for artists, and for giving a gift of art, doing something special that involves the arts, etc. She has been hosting these events since 1998, and has gotten artists from all over to participate.

Barbara went over the need to get “better world” art out more broadly on social media so as to make a more positive impact in society and out-create much of the degradation that currently exists. Member Randy Tobin had the idea of starting a You Tube channel for the group, and popularizing artists in this manner. There was much agreement from the group on this.

The tone of the meeting was strong interest, and several agreed to wear various hats with the group. Existing members were acknowledged for what they have been doing over the years, and will continue. There was talk about future coordination meetings, and a few even offered their homes.
